Abstract

fetched live from OpenAlex

This research presents the first evidence that moderate fecundity was conducive for long-run reproductive success within the human species. Exploiting an ex-tensive genealogy record for nearly half a million individuals in Quebec during the seventeenth and eighteenth centuries, the study traces the number of de-scendants of early inhabitants in the subsequent four generations. Using the time interval between the date of marriage and the first live birth as a measure of reproductive capacity, the research establishes that while a higher fecundity is associated with a larger number of children, an intermediate level maximizes long-run reproductive success. The finding further indicates that the optimal level of fecundity was below the population median, suggesting that the forces of natural selection favored individuals with a lower level of fecundity. The research lends credence to the hypothesis that during the Malthusian epoch, natural selection favored individuals with a larger predisposition towards child quality, contributing to the onset of the demographic transition and the evolu-tion of societies from an epoch of stagnation to sustained economic growth.
